WebOct 6, 2024 · To tag a specific commit id and push back to the remote repository, follow these two steps: Tag the commit with this command: git tag -a M1 e3afd034 -m "Tag Message". Specify the tag in the git push command:: git push origin M1. When the second command completes, the tagged commit id that was pushed back will be identifiable on …

I'll name my git-test. mkdir git-test && cd git-test. The above commands will create a folder and navigate to that folder. You can run these commands in your terminal. To initialize a new git repo, run the following command in that folder. git init. In the "Changes" tab in the left sidebar: The red icon indicates removed files. The yellow icon indicates modified files. The green icon indicates added files.
